Every day, our feet support the weight of our bodies as we go about our daily activities. However, many of us don’t realize the importance of proper arch support in preventing foot pain and discomfort. Arch support plays a crucial role in maintaining the natural alignment of the foot and providing stability and cushioning to help prevent foot pain and other related issues.
One of the most common causes of foot pain is overpronation or flat feet, where the arch of the foot collapses and the foot rolls inward excessively with each step. This can lead to an uneven distribution of pressure, strain on the muscles, ligaments, and tendons, and eventually result in pain and discomfort in the feet, ankles, knees, hips, and lower back. Wearing shoes with inadequate arch support or spending long hours on your feet can exacerbate these problems.
Inserting arch support insoles or orthotics into your shoes can help correct biomechanical imbalances, provide additional support and cushioning, and alleviate foot pain. These devices are designed to support the arch of the foot, redistribute pressure evenly, absorb shock, and improve alignment and posture. They can also help with conditions such as plantar fasciitis, heel spurs, bunions, and arthritis by reducing strain on the affected areas and promoting natural foot function.
By providing the necessary support and stability, arch support can help prevent injuries, improve comfort and performance, and enhance overall foot health. It can also help reduce fatigue, improve posture, and prevent the development of conditions that can result from poor foot mechanics. Investing in high-quality shoes with proper arch support or custom-made orthotic inserts can make a significant difference in your comfort and well-being.
In addition to wearing supportive footwear, there are other ways to strengthen the arches and prevent foot pain, such as stretching and strengthening exercises, maintaining a healthy weight, avoiding high heels and flip-flops, and choosing appropriate footwear for different activities. It’s also important to listen to your body, rest when needed, and seek professional help if you experience persistent foot pain or discomfort.
